Recognizing Cataracts: Causes and Signs and symptoms
Cataracts are like a gloomy veil that progressively covers your vision, making day-to-day jobs challenging. They create when proteins in your eye's lens clump together, creating it to come to be gloomy.
Age is the most typical cause, yet factors like diabetic issues, prolonged sun exposure, and cigarette smoking can enhance your threat. You may discover blurred or dark vision, problem seeing at night, or sensitivity to light. Colors may seem faded, and you might have to transform your glasses often.
If you find yourself having problem with these signs and symptoms, it's necessary to speak with an eye care specialist. Understanding cataracts can help you take proactive action in managing your eye health and wellness and getting ready for possible therapy options.
The Cataract Surgical Treatment Refine: What to Expect
When you make a decision to undertake cataract surgical treatment, it's all-natural to really feel a mix of expectancy and anxiety concerning the procedure.
First, your surgeon will certainly describe the treatment and respond to any type of questions. You'll likely undertake a pre-operative analysis to guarantee you're ready for surgery.
On the day of the surgery, you'll reach the surgical facility, where you'll obtain anesthesia to keep you comfy. The treatment itself generally takes about 15 to 30 minutes.
Your cosmetic surgeon will make a tiny laceration in your eye to eliminate the over cast lens and change it with an artificial one. Throughout, you'll be kept track of carefully.
When the surgical treatment is full, you'll rest briefly before heading home, usually with boosted vision in simply a few days.
Recuperation and Dangers: Browsing the Post-Operative Trip
Although the surgical treatment might be over, your journey does not finish there; healing is a critical stage that calls for interest and treatment. You'll likely experience some discomfort, however that ought to slowly fade.
Follow your specialist's instructions closely, consisting of eye declines and activity limitations. Safeguard your eyes from brilliant lights and prevent strenuous activities for a couple of weeks.
Be aware of prospective threats, like infection or swelling. If you see enhanced discomfort, abrupt vision adjustments, or discharge, call your medical professional today.
Regular follow-up appointments are important to check your healing procedure. Remember, patience is key; your vision will certainly improve over time.
